# Hermetic Build Migration: Limits and Quotas

As discussed at the weekly sync, the Larkspan build is moving to the Quarryline hermetic toolchain. Hermetic sandboxes enforce hard caps on open file descriptors, network access (none), and scratch disk per action. Targets exceeding these caps fail deterministically rather than degrading. Most Larkspan targets fit comfortably; the codegen steps for the Mossfield schema are the exception and were tuned separately. Current per-action limits are as follows.

tuning table, yajog-yahof:
BUDGETS = {
    "lamvan": 303,
    "wenox": 460,
    "fenvan": 525,
}

For external plugin authors. Three environments: sandbox, cert, prod. Sandbox is wiped nightly; push anything. Cert mirrors prod versions and is where your validator plugin must pass conformance before listing. Prod is invite-only; plugins deploy there through our release pipeline, never directly. Plugin API versions may differ between sandbox and cert during a platform rollout — check the banner on the portal. Resource quotas are tighter in cert than sandbox by design. Each environment's plugin host runs with the following configuration.

service settings:
WENATH_PIN=5007
WENATH_METRICS_HOST=metrics.wenath.tolvaqlabs.corp
WENATH_LOG_LEVEL=debug
WENATH_TENANT=rusox

Q2 Planning — Cash-Flow Forecast

Forecast tightens in Q2. Receivables from the Ardwick account are slipping 45+ days; collections escalating. Sales leads: prioritize deals with upfront payment terms and hold discounting above 10% for approval. Capex deferred except the Norrell tooling spend. Updated targets issue next week. The confidential note below covers the plan assumptions behind these numbers.

board note of tawig-bajof: The renewal with Ralixix Holdings closes at $10 million a year, 20 percent above the last contract. Project Druix slips by two quarters because of the tooling delay.